Commonwealth v. Hallinan

SJC-13301
Argue Date: Wednesday December 7, 2022
*Summary:   Criminal—The defendant is seeking to withdraw her admission to sufficient facts in a charge of operating a motor vehicle while under the influence of liquor on the ground of misconduct by the Office of Alcohol Testing involving certain breathalyzer results.
Justices: Budd, C.J., Gaziano, Lowy, Cypher, Kafker, Wendlandt, Georges, Jr., JJ.
Appellant: Lindsay A. Hallinan
Counsel for Appellant: Joseph D. Bernard, Esquire Murat Erkan, Esquire
Appellee: Commonwealth
Counsel for Appellee: David F. O'Sullivan, A.D.A. Catherine L. Semel, A.D.A.
Court Appealed From: Salem District, ES
Lower Court Judge: Robert A. Brennan, J.
Route to SJC: Direct Appellate Review
Amici Curiae: Committee for Public Counsel Services , Massachusetts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ers , Massachusetts Registry of Motor Vehicles
